    Have you looked at Peplink vs Teltonika?

    • @WillieHowe
      @WillieHowe  2 месяца назад

      We use Peplink, Cradlepoint, Sierra, and Teltonika. As far as features to price, Teltonika leads the pack -- unless we're looking for a true bonding solution -- then we go with Peplink.
